Coronavirus: Netanyahu Urged to Help Israel's Diamond Industry

By John Jeffay / July 13, 2020 / www.idexonline.com / Article Link

(IDEX Online) - The president of the Israel Diamond Exchange has made an impassioned plea for the government to help an industry that has lost $600m to COVID-19."We are turning to you with an urgent request to help the diamond industry, which is on the brink of collapse as a result of the coronavirus," says Yoram Dvash (pictured) in a personal letter to President Benjamin Netanyahu.He says 15,000 families who rely directly or indirectly on diamonds in Israel have been affected by a decline in exports estimated at 80 per cent between March and May.Many workers have already lost their jobs and many companies may relocate to other countries he warns.Mr Dvash, who is also acting president of the World Federation of Diamond Bourses, calls on the government to guarantee bank lines of credit, provide grants to business and help promote the industry.He says steps taken so far by the government have done little to protect one of Israel's oldest and most important export industries.Israel was initially among the world's most successful countries at tackling COVID-19, but since relaxing a nationwide lockdown infection rates have reached record high levels.
